Output 842d69b15dfa2eb879908ae04b8eb7909bb4e996e850bfb3f99758d523a26dc6:0

value
593487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5af6d8a3d6ac8c83ef2d1bf5ac1a51839b77773 OP_EQUAL
address
3KiHCH527vPSAbzpjm2CpLKywGbXj4CfmT
transaction
842d69b15dfa2eb879908ae04b8eb7909bb4e996e850bfb3f99758d523a26dc6
spent
true